Output c7a43c2bf9ed07f3f9401649969b81ecfdbb9501530d6fb2901c21c0b2848aac:27

value
636400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edb21f64a8c1696cc0c400fd117356b29a78cd66 OP_EQUAL
address
3PMqTBg4jCA9U49VJJqMywyZuPKScU7wTs
transaction
c7a43c2bf9ed07f3f9401649969b81ecfdbb9501530d6fb2901c21c0b2848aac
confirmations
322128
spent
true